spacex: Frequently Asked Questions
What is spacex?
Spacex is a private aerospace manufacturer and space transport services company founded by Elon Musk.
What is Starlink?
Starlink is a satellite constellation developed by spacex to provide global internet coverage.
What is Starship?
Starship is a spacecraft developed by spacex for long-duration missions to the Moon, Mars, and other destinations in the solar system.
